In the field of engineering, particularly in structural analysis and design, the concept of a beam of variable cross-section plays a crucial role. This term refers to a beam whose cross-sectional area changes along its length. Such beams are commonly used in various applications, including bridges, buildings, and other structures where varying loads are present. The ability to design a beam of variable cross-section allows engineers to optimize material usage while ensuring structural integrity and performance.One of the primary advantages of using a beam of variable cross-section is that it can be tailored to meet specific load requirements. For instance, in a bridge design, the central portion of the beam may need to support more weight than the ends. By increasing the cross-sectional area in the middle and tapering it at the ends, engineers can create a more efficient structure. This not only reduces the amount of material needed but also minimizes the overall weight of the beam, which is essential for maintaining stability and safety.Moreover, the design of a beam of variable cross-section can significantly improve the aesthetic appeal of a structure. Architects often collaborate with engineers to create visually striking designs that incorporate these types of beams. By varying the shape and size of the beam, they can achieve unique architectural features that enhance the overall look of a building or bridge. This integration of functionality and aesthetics is vital in modern architecture, where both form and function must be considered.Another important aspect of beam of variable cross-section design is the analysis of stress distribution. When a beam is subjected to loads, the stress does not remain constant throughout its length. Understanding how the stress varies allows engineers to predict potential failure points and make necessary adjustments during the design phase. Advanced software tools and simulation techniques enable engineers to model these variations and ensure that the beam will perform as expected under various conditions.Furthermore, the use of materials in a beam of variable cross-section can also vary. Engineers may choose different materials for different sections of the beam based on their properties, such as strength, weight, and cost. This hybrid approach can lead to even greater efficiencies and innovations in beam design.In conclusion, the concept of a beam of variable cross-section is fundamental in engineering and architecture. It allows for the creation of structures that are not only functional but also aesthetically pleasing. By understanding the principles behind these beams, engineers can optimize designs to meet specific load requirements while minimizing material usage. As technology advances, we can expect to see even more innovative uses of beam of variable cross-section designs in future construction projects, paving the way for stronger, lighter, and more beautiful structures.
